            BTW, Coach Cole sorta, kinda, vaguely released UAH's 2010-11 schedule.

            http://saveuahhockey.com/2009/12/19/...11-and-beyond/

            H - Ferris
            A - Mich State
            A - BGSU
            A - Wisco
            H - Providence
            H - Bemidji
            Mercyhurst (?)
            UNO (?)
            RPI Tournament
            H - RPI
            Cornell (?)
            A - Colorado College
            H - USNDP

            At 30 games announced, there are two weekends unaccounted for here. No dates, this is not necessarily the order of games either, except that he said explicitly that we open the season at home against Ferris.

            The coaching staff is working on adding two more home series. If USNDP comes through, they have the option of adding a 35th game (only one game against U-18 can be exempted from the 34-game limit).

                    As a side note, the last time each of those teams came to Huntsville:

                    Bemidji - Duh.
                    Providence - Dec. 8-9, 1989 (only four meetings ever, last in 1994)
                    Ferris State - Never since varsity program (March 2, 1986 -- club team), only three games ever between the teams.
                    USNDP - Never played
                    RPI - Nov. 30 and Dec. 1, 1991 (only meeting between the teams)
